Fans of US rapper Pitbull have set the first Guinness World Record for the largest gathering of people wearing bald caps.
22,141 fans wore the caps in London's Hyde Park at a concert on Friday ahead of Pitbull's set at the British Summer Time (BST) festival.
Many of them also sported suits, black aviator sunglasses and fake goatees - all hallmarks of the singer's signature style. It has become a trend for fans to dress as Pitbull while attending his performances.
"Record breaking, record making, history in the making," said the 45-year-old hip hop artist before being presented with a certificate.
"Thank you London, thank you to the fans, thank you Hyde Park, thank you to the bald-es," he added.
Pitbull was the first person to attempt the feat under official adjudication, meaning there was no previous record to beat.
The Miami-born star's hits include "Fireball", "Timber", "Time Of Our Lives", and "On the Floor".
